Subject: House Numbers and Numerology

Question
I can pick my house number.  What will be the best and why?
228, 230, 232, 234,  these are my choices.
Nancy thank you for your time.

Answer
Hi Nancy,

Smart of you to carefully weigh your options.

You ask which house number, 228, 230, 232, or 234 will be best and why.

I must ask you, best for what? For gaining insight? For working out of your home? For quiet time alone? For the arts? For sensual adventures?

It also largely depends on how each number harmonizes with your personal energy, and especially your timing.

228 reduces to 11 and the root number 2; 230 reduces to 5; 232 reduces to 7, and 234 reduces to 9 (see below for more info about "final digiting").

Although it is important to consider each individual number of the triple digit numbers, it's best to focus first on the root numbers.

11, 2, 7, and 9 include mostly spiritual and non-material energies. 5 is very mundane and often relates to much change and adjustments.

Subject: Number Symbolism and Addresses

Dear Scott and Stephen,

I am moving into a new flat. The unit number
is 4 and the building number is 77. Is the
building number more important for me to
consider in numerology terms or the flat
number or both? And if so, are these numbers
good?

Many thanks,
Gabrielle

Scott and Stephen’s Response:

Dear Gabrielle,

First, you must consider that the residence
or office numbers don’t make things happen,
nor do they hold direct power over anything.

Your application of numerology to figure out
if a possible home will enhance your life is
pre-destined, in our view. You’re just carrying
out your destiny, despite it possibly appearing
as manipulation of your life circumstances
(previewing the energy associated with possible
residences) through number symbolism.

A soul selects a specific time to incarnate. That
point of origin (birth) as indicated by a date and
time reflects its qualities and its past, present
and future through the science of numerology.
Numerology can be used in virtually every area
of life and some people are fated to capitalize on
the wisdom found through it and some aren’t.

Although calendars appear to start at arbitrary
times, everything in this universe is interrelated,
including systems used to track time. We say
this to emphasize our conviction that little in this
universe occurs by chance.

Even though unit numbers may seem to be
randomly assigned, they too, like everything else
in the world, are part of the cosmic universal
cohesiveness.

The numbers of any residence, no matter which
one you decide to acquire, always reflect what is
and what is to be.

In brief, you can’t just select any “good” unit
number for yourself and then “create your
reality” to satisfy all your ego-self desires,
but you can use numerology to help intensify
your awareness.   

Key life opportunities and probabilities are
hidden within the qualities of numbers. Note
that numbers reflect quantity, such as party
of five, and quality, as in he’s number one.

It’s good to consider the building number,
but the unit number carries more importance
in the case of an apartment, condominium,
office, or other separate unit within a building.

Most people want stability in a home. The
root numbers 4 and 6 are most fitting toward
that desire, and there are other numbers that
are more appropriate for other conditions.

You ask if the numbers 4 and 77 are good.
There aren’t bad or good numbers, but there
are rewarding and challenging energies
associated with every number. The Number
Symbolism list below can assist you in your
understanding of the distinct energies behind
the root numbers 1 through 9. The Number
Symbolism list can also be applied toward any
person, place, or thing and is best used in
conjunction with our numerology software.

Use fadic addition to reduce all building, house,
and unit numbers to a single digit. For example,
7736 = 7+7+3+6 = 23 = 2+3 = 5.

At this time, don’t concern yourself with
translating the street name, city, or any other
part of the address to numbers. Just focus on
the numbers directly connected to the building,
house, and unit.

The remaining parts of the address including the
individual numbers of the original multiple-digit
number also have relative representation, but
those are topics for advanced study. Master
Numbers (11, 22, 33, 44, 55, 66, 77, 88, and 99)
and Karmic Debt Numbers (13, 14, 16, and 19)
are also more involved subjects.

With no numerology background, it’s easy to
miss the importance of number symbolism. But
once you begin to pay attention to and correctly
interpret the energy behind numbers, you begin
to realize the incredible insight available to
anyone willing to take a closer look.  

Number Symbolism
Copyright © 1998, 2003 Scott A. Petullo Corporation

1: The number 1 is connected with new starts, independence, new opportunity, inspiration, originality, standing alone, concentration, leadership, determination, self-employment, courage and isolation.
Balanced 1 energy: initiative, energetic, persistent, creative, confident, ambitious, self-reliant, dynamic, bold, forward looking, assertive.
Over-balanced 1 energy: selfish, impatient, elitist,
intolerant, addicted, aggressive, self-important, unyielding, headstrong, defiant, dictatorial, self-at-all-cost attitude, arrogant, domineering, possessive, greedy.
Under-balanced 1 energy: passive, weak will, cowardly,
dependent, insecure, subservient, helpless, lack of
self-respect, changeable, weary.

2: The number 2 is linked to sensitivity, teamwork,
partnerships, marriage, love, divorce, friendships, details, public recognition, tolerance, modesty, receptivity, behind the scenes work, cooperation, rhythm, harmony, and slow growth.
Balanced 2 energy: tactful, sensitive, harmonizing,
flexible, diplomatic, helpful, patient, sincere, modest,
cautious, courteous, receptive.
Over-balanced 2 energy: scheming, deceitful,
manipulative, faultfinding, resentfully resisting,
devious, condescending, disapproving, interfering.
Under-balanced 2 energy: unresponsive, cowardly,
self-depreciating, dependent, inactive, self-depreciating,
indecisive, vacillating, overly sensitive, uncaring.

3: The number 3 is related to laughter, amusement,
pleasure, making new friends, self-improvement,
attracting love, sexual expression, artistic creativity,
writing, good times, quick recoveries, dramatic emotional
ups and downs, easy money and instability.
Balanced 3 energy: honest emotional expression,
optimistic, literary talent, vivacious, cultivated,
amusing, imaginative, well liked, magnetic.
Over-balanced 3 energy: lacks concentration,
scatters energy, overconfident, emotionally volatile,
irresponsible, gossipy, exaggerating, superficial.
Under-balanced 3 energy: insincere emotional
expression, temperamental, petty, depressed,
jealous, unsociable, self-doubting, bored, inarticulate,
unthinking, indecisive, unenthusiastic, apprehensive.

4: The number 4 is associated with material interests,
structure, managing finances, creating foundations that
last, work, business success, stable finances, routine,
organization, putting ideas into form, efficiency, physical activity, health matters, limitation and lack of fun and excitement.
Balanced 4 energy: productive, reliable, thrifty, cautious, disciplined, integrity, methodical, analysis, serious, balanced, loyal, sensible, persevering.
Over-balanced 4 energy: rigid, narrow-minded, inflexible,
rough, dreary, numb emotions, uncompromising, provincial,
too frank, lost in detail.
Under-balanced 4 energy: apathetic, disorganized, lack
of integrity, impractical, plodding, careless, inefficient, distracted, idle, neglectful.

5: The number 5 is related to advertising, promotion, sales, sensuality, sex, freedom, travel, communication, changes, fluctuation, flexibility, excitement, adventure, transmutation.
Balanced 5 energy: multifaceted, broadminded, healthy
limits, appropriately dissolving career or personal
relationships at the right time, forward-thinking,
charming, curious, adaptable, independent, clever,
resourceful, liberated.
Over-balanced 5 energy: over-indulgent, mercurial,
over-sexed, reckless, ending relationships too soon,
impatient, thrill-seeking, erratic, extreme independence,
insatiable, restless.
Under-balanced 5 energy: fear of change, stagnant,
dependent, hanging on to associations that have expired,
conforming, fear of freedom, dull, ineffective, expressionless.

6: The number 6 is linked to domestic issues, home and
family, relationships, marriage, divorce, romance,
responsibility, friendships, karma, emotions, slow moving
energy, harmony, teaching, healthy balanced living.
Balanced 6 energy: domestic, advising, friendly, tolerant,
supportive, appreciative, peace-making, protective,
humanitarian, responsible, devoted, loving, stable, sensible.
Over-balanced 6 energy: distorted idealism, critical,
interfering, opinionated, possessive, stubborn, sacrificing, unreasonable obstinate, unforgiving, disheartened.
Under-balanced 6 energy: uncaring, uncooperative,
biased, unconcerned, indulgent, lethargic, unwelcoming,
non-committal, disconsolate.

7: The number 7 is connected to mysticism, intuition,
inner growth, examination, study, analysis, reflection,
lowered physical vitality, increased mental activity,
conserving assets, planning, attracting unsolicited help,
specialization, solitude, health issues, travel.
Balanced 7 energy: metaphysical interests, different
wavelength, intellectual, clairvoyant, analytical, perceptive, scientific, exact, meditative, mystical, expert, bookish, poised, telepathic, visionary, deep, dreamer, instinctive, reflective, truth-seeker, studious, wise.
Over-balanced 7 energy: fearful, nervous, critical,
paranoid, indecisive, secretive, repressed emotions,
distrustful, guarded, intimidating, fussy, evasive, fanatic, self-conscious, secretive, perfectionist, impersonal, pessimistic.
Under-balanced 7 energy: lack of depth, naïve, ignorant,
too trusting, empty-headed, mystified, superficial, lack of faith, undeveloped, uninformed, unsure.

8: The number 8 is tied to influence, money, karma, action, business success, business failure, control, material objects, status, loss, gain, administration, management, ego, leadership, power.
Balanced 8 energy: prosperous, high-powered,
commanding, stamina, self-confident, persuasive, financial
awareness, effective, ambitious, businesslike, clear-headed, disciplined, material freedom, honorable, enterprising.
Over-balanced 8 energy: abuses power, cold-blooded,
egotistical, overreaction to money, scheming, aggressive,
materialistic, corrupt, demanding, domineering, preoccupied with power and money, unsympathetic, over-ambitious, confrontational, rebellious, coarse.
Under-balanced 8 energy: passive, vulnerable, fearful,
insecure, avoids power and money, poor judgment, gives
personal power away, shortsighted.
 
9: The number 9 is associated with unconditional love,
reward, leadership by example, dramatic endings, emotional
love, emotional crisis, the finest life has to offer, conclusions, deep love, compassion, magnetism, travel, idealism, charity, artistic and creative matters, developing spirituality,
romance, forgiveness.
Balanced 9 energy: artistic, philanthropic, affectionate,
creative, forgiving, passionate, benevolent, warm, tolerant, sentimental, loving, liberal, generous, enthusiastic, trustworthy, hospitable, humane.
Over-balanced 9 energy: deceiving, self-centered, hedonistic, lacking integrity, over-emotional, prejudiced, resentful, bad example, irresolute, dejected, vindictive, hateful, hostile.
Under-balanced 9 energy: ultraconservative, impersonal,
distant, unemotional, elusive, submissive, drifting, faint-hearted, victimized, disloyal, hazy.

Numbers Behind Letters: A J S = 1, B K T = 2, C L U = 3,
D M V = 4, E N W = 5, F O X = 6, G P Y = 7, H Q Z = 8,
I R = 9
